Railways has launched an investigation to find out the reason for the accident, however passenger teams argue that the incident may have been prevented if the 12810 Howrah-Mumbai mail had left on time.
Shesh Nath Pathak, of Jamshedpur Passengers Affiliation, stated the mail prepare was anticipated to reach at Tatanagar at 11pm on Monday. Nevertheless it arrived three hours late, leading to a delayed journey to its subsequent cease, Chakradharpur.”Resulting from late arrival at Tatanagar, the prepare chugged off late and met with an accident”, he added. Pathak additionally steered that the mail prepare’s pilot could have been dashing the locomotive to compensate for the delay.
Suresh Sonthlia, ex-functionary of Zonal Railway Passengers Affiliation, acknowledged that each passenger prepare and items trains’ pilots are beneath immense stress to fulfill deadlines.
“It’s a matter of investigation to establish the precise explanation for the accident, however psychological stress on the pilots to fulfill the deadline can also be a reality,” he stated.
